Changeset 7958 for branches/2.5/prototype/modules/calendar/interceptors
- Timestamp:
- 03/05/13 14:35:40 (11 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
branches/2.5/prototype/modules/calendar/interceptors/DBMapping.php
r7747 r7958 164 164 165 165 public function encodeSignatureAlarmType(&$uri, &$params, &$criteria, $original) { 166 $params['type'] = self::codeAlarmType($params['type']); 166 $params['type'] = self::codeAlarmType($params['type']); 167 } 168 169 public function schedulableSecurity(&$uri, &$params, &$criteria, $original) 170 { 171 $security = 'schedulable.id = calendarToSchedulable.schedulable'; 172 $security .= ' AND calendar.id = calendarToSchedulable.calendar'; 173 $security .= ' AND calendar.id = calendarSignature.calendar'; 174 $security .= ' AND calendarSignature.user = ' . base64_encode(Config::me('uidNumber')); 175 176 $criteria['condition'] = $security; 177 } 178 179 public function calendarSecurity(&$uri, &$params, &$criteria, $original) 180 { 181 $security = 'calendar.id = calendarSignature.calendar'; 182 $security .= ' AND calendarSignature.user = ' . base64_encode(Config::me('uidNumber')); 183 184 $criteria['condition'] = $security; 185 } 186 187 public function calendarSignatureSecurity(&$uri, &$params, &$criteria, $original) 188 { 189 $security = 'calendarSignature.user = ' . base64_encode(Config::me('uidNumber')); 190 191 $criteria['condition'] = $security; 167 192 } 168 193
Note: See TracChangeset
for help on using the changeset viewer.